
Senior Product Manager, Community & Growth (Flickr)
The Role
At Flickr, we are in an exciting phase of growth. The opportunity in front of this role is getting more photographers to that moment faster—the moment they find their people, post their first photo, join their first group, and realize this is where they belong. That moment is what this role is built around.
If you thrive in ambiguity, love building products that bring people together, and want to own the funnel that turns photographers into long-term Pro subscribers, this is your opportunity.
Your Opportunity
Own the Get team roadmap end to end, set the strategic priorities, track progress against subscription growth goals, and communicate results and learnings to leadership on a regular cadence.
Build and evolve the community and growth strategy, bringing a clear point of view on where the biggest opportunities are and making the case for how to go after them.
Define the strategic opportunity, set the direction, and drive alignment from the first brief to the final launch.
Drive the full acquisition and onboarding funnel from signup through community activation and first-month engagement, with direct accountability for moving the metrics that matter.
Design and run a rigorous experimentation program across the funnel, write your own briefs, synthesize learnings, and compound results over time.
Own legal and compliance requirements across login, signup, and onboarding, partnering with Legal and Trust & Safety.
Partner with the platform team to ensure the app is a best-in-class acquisition and activation surface.
Work closely with marketing on acquisition strategy and campaigns as the product voice for how new users are introduced to Flickr.
Partner with the other product teams on roadmap planning, make hard tradeoff calls that balance Get priorities against broader business outcomes, and build alignment even when priorities compete.
What You Bring
6+ years of product management experience with a track record of owning and shipping significant growth or community products at a senior level.
A strategic leader who can set the vision and execute it. You define the roadmap, influence across the organization, and drive outcomes with or without a large team behind you.
Deeply data-informed and comfortable getting into the numbers yourself, translating what you find into strategic decisions not just observations. SQL skills are a strong plus.
Design fluency. You value high UX quality, can give clear and actionable direction to designers, and use prototyping and early visuals to align teams before committing to build.
You raise the bar on PM craft around you. You write clear specs, run tight roadmap reviews, and set a standard for how product work gets done that makes everyone on the team better.
A strong track record with acquisition and growth metrics: onboarding completion, signup conversion, funnel optimization, and LTV.
Proven experimentation chops. You know how to design a rigorous test, read results honestly, separate signal from noise, and build a compounding program that gets smarter over time.
Experience with community, social, or subscription products where engagement and conversion were central to growth.
Comfortable in a fast-moving, resource-constrained environment. You have worked in a startup or agile setting where priorities shift, teams are lean, and the ability to move quickly without losing quality is what separates good from great.
Builds and owns the business case for your bets, connecting product decisions directly to subscription revenue and growth outcomes.
Influences without authority. You move engineering, marketing, community, and support toward a shared goal through clarity, trust, and the strength of your thinking, not through hierarchy.
Resourceful and decisive with a builder mindset. You make high-quality decisions with incomplete information, translate vision into execution, iterate based on results, and treat being wrong as useful information not failure.
A growth mindset and a genuine commitment to the people around you, championing our culture of collaboration and development and our #GROWTOGETHER values.

A Little About Us
Our purpose is simple: building a better world through the power of photography. For over two decades, we have led the photography industry and thrived as a private, mission-focused, values-led company. We are a Certified Evergreen brand. We are also a Certified Great Place to Work, Climate Neutral Certified, and members of the Conservation Alliance.
We’re building iconic brands that connect people through photography and unleash the value of the stories they tell. We make products that thrill photographers of all types, crafting experiences that empower them to preserve their precious memories, share their art, and run their businesses.
A career at Awesome is much more than a job. Our people come first, and we invest in their growth and prioritize their well-being. Your work will contribute to our mission while leaving a positive, lasting impact on our community and our world.
Our expanding family of brands includes SmugMug, Flickr, and MODE events.
